Dos Almas De Espana

The Music

  • I Want to Spend My Lifetime Loving You
    (Theme from The Mask of Zorro)
  • Leyenda
    (Asturias) - by Isaac Albeniz (1860-1909)
    This song is built around the flamenco from Granainas. It’s title comes from the northern mining province of Spain. It was composed originally as part of the Suite Española. Isaac Albeniz once told Francisco Tarrega that he preferred Tarrega’s guitar transcription over his own on the piano.
  • Romance
    (Spanish Ballad) - Anonymous
    An anonymous piece that is at least two centuries old. It was written as a waltz and is sometimes heard as a rumba today.
  • Andalucia
    by Ernesto Lecuona
    Played here with an underlying compas (rhyhm) of the traditional flamenco bulerias, originating in the south of Spain in a region known as "Andalucia".
  • Recuerdos de la Alhambra
    by Francisco Tarrega (1852-1909)
    Written one evening in Granada in 1896 after an afternoon visit to the 14th century palace. It was titled "A la Alhambra" (Invocation) in the hand-written manuscript, but was published as it’s world renowned title, "Recuerdos de la Alhambra".
  • Adagio from "The Concerto de Aranjuez"
    by Joaquin Rodrigo (1901)
    The most popular guitar concerto ever written beguiles the listener with it’s evocation of the ancient palace of Aranjuez and colorful pageantry attendant to the Spanish courts. This piece was written in Paris during the Spanish Civil War.
  • Capricho Arabe
    by Francisco Tarrega (1852-1909)
    Written in Barcelona about 1890 while playing his 1888 Don Antonio de Torres guitar (Spruce top with Rosewood back and sides). This song evokes the sounds of the Laud and Bandurria Rondallas (Spanish folkloric mandolin ensembles) that fills every province of Spain.
  • Andante and Rondo #3 from Trois Rondo Brillants Op. 2
    by Dionisio Aguado
    Written in Spain, but published in Paris by Chez Messionnier in 1825 shortly after Aguado’s arrival to begin concertizing in the city of light. One of Aguado’s truly virtuoso early works.
  • Homenaje de Sacromonte - Granainas
    by Anthony Arizaga
    The flamenco form from Granada with it’s Moorish arabescos is a delineation of the group of songs known as Fandangos Grandes.
  • Corazon Profunda - Siguiriyas
    by Anthony Arizaga
    The most gypsy of all flamenco songs; nothing is more emotional than a Siguiriyas.
  • La Tristesa - Peteneras
    by Anthony Arizaga
    The flamenco song of legend ~ Once upon a time there was a very beautiful lady of the evening who loved to destroy men’s hearts, who befell her own tragic end at the hands of one of her cast off lovers.
  • La Leyenda de Juan Breva - Malagueña
    by Anthony Arizaga
    This musical style, originally developed by Juan Breva (1843-1918) and named after the province of the port city Malaga, was popularized by Ernesto Lecuona in the late ’50’s.
